TPS7A0225PDQNR by Texas Instruments

TPS7A0225PDQNR by Texas Instruments is a fixed positive single output LDO regulator with a max dropout voltage of 0.36V and an operating temperature range from -40°C to 125°C. It has a nominal output voltage of 2.5V, making it suitable for applications requiring stable voltage regulation in compact electronic devices.

Feature Benefit Bullets

Package Body Material: PLASTIC/EPOXY

This material provides durability and protection for the regulator, ensuring a longer lifespan.

Maximum Dropout Voltage-1: 0.36 V

Low dropout voltage ensures efficient power conversion and minimal power loss.

Surface Mount: YES

Ease of installation and compatibility with modern PCB designs.

Operating Temperature (TJ-Max): 125 °C

Wide temperature range allows for reliable operation in various environmental conditions.

Minimum Output Voltage-1: 2.4625 V

Stable minimum output voltage ensures consistent performance of connected devices.

Nominal Output Voltage-1: 2.5 V

Precise nominal output voltage for accurate power supply to the load.

No. of Terminals: 4

Simplified connections for easy integration into circuit designs.

Adjustability: FIXED

Fixed output eliminates the need for adjustment, providing simplicity and reliability.

Maximum Output Current-1: 0.2 A

Adequate output current for powering various low-power applications.

Texas Instruments

Texas Instruments Inc. (TI) is one of the world's leading semiconductor companies and a global leader in analog and digital signal processing technology. The company has had a major impact on the electronics industry for over 80 years, manufacturing integrated circuits (ICs), software and subsystems that leverage high-performance computing capabilities. It offers an extensive portfolio of solutions for a wide range of industries, from aerospace to medical devices and consumer products to communication systems. Over its long history, TI has become synonymous with quality, reliability and innovation. Today, TI is one of the largest semiconductor companies in the world with operations in more than 30 countries across six continents.
